Pchełki SQL, odcinek 19: koszmar z ulicy Wiązów

Dzisiejsza pchełka to żart mojego autorstwa, który prezentuję z całą obrzydliwą bezwstydnością.

Kto pierwszy zgadnie (w komentarzu) jaki będzie wynik działania poniższego kodu, dostanie w prezencie uśmiech pana prezesa.

DECLARE @declare BIGINT = convert(bigint, 3) * convert(bigint, 73) * 457155763 , @table SMALLINT = 4, @insert VARCHAR(4) = ''; 
DECLARE @select INT = @declare / power(10, power(@table/2,@table-1))-1; 
SELECT @table [pivot], @declare %  @select [from] INTO #merge; 
INSERT #merge 
SELECT @table - 1, (@declare - @declare % @select) / @select % @select 
UNION ALL SELECT @table - 2, ((@declare - @declare % @select) / @select - (@declare - @declare % @select) / @select % @select) / @select % @select 
UNION ALL SELECT @table - 3, ((((@declare - @declare % @select) / @select - (@declare - @declare %  @select) / @select % @select) / @select) - (((@declare - @declare %  @select) / @select - (@declare - @declare % @select) / @select % @select) / @select % @select)) / @select; 
SELECT @insert += CHAR([from]) FROM #merge ORDER BY [pivot]; 
DROP TABLE #merge; 
SELECT @insert wynik;

Kto wyjaśni DLACZEGO wynik jest taki a nie inny, dodatkowo otrzyma oficjalną pochwałę (również w komentarzu), wystawioną przeze mnie osobiście.

Nagrody są soczyste, a więc – do boju!


4
Dodaj komentarz

avatar
2 Comment threads
2 Thread replies
0 Followers
 
Most reacted comment
Hottest comment thread
3 Comment authors
d3xxpilButter Recent comment authors
  Subscribe  
najnowszy najstarszy oceniany
Powiadom o
Butter
Gość
Butter

Odpowiedź na pierwszą część: dupa.

A jest taki, bo wyniki finezyjnych operacji dają takie a nie inne kody ascii.

d3x
Gość
d3x

chyba niechcacy wygralem na PMach 🙂 przepraszam 🙂

%d bloggers like this: